Most remodel stress comes from three things: unclear scope, surprise costs, and not knowing what happens next.
We act as your advocate by protecting your home, your budget, and your peace of mind with a disciplined process.
A disciplined process that protects your home, your budget, and your peace of mind.
-
We start with an in-home consult to understand your goals, take measurements, talk rough numbers, and most importantly, discover whether we are a great fit for the project.
P.S. even if we are not a great fit, we likely know someone who is, and would be happy to refer you. -
We turn your ideas into a build-ready plan. We confirm material selections (with our team or alongside your interior designer), then map the planning and permit path needed to move forward.
Next, we build a highly transparent, line-item scope and a guaranteed-max proposal for the defined scope. We walk you through it so you know exactly what’s included, what it costs, and what comes next.
-
After signing the proposal, before we start construction, we collect the initial deposit, set the calendar in stone, and get materials on hand.
-
We protect the home, manage subs and inspections, do milestone reviews, provide daily updates, give you a client portal where you can track everything, and use written change orders only.
P.S. if change orders are related to anything that we missed in our initial scope, that’s billed at-cost to you. If it truly involves new scope, we will go through the estimating process again. -
We like to finish strong. To close out the project, we complete an internal punch list, client punch list, deep clean with pro cleaners, final walkthrough, and then your final invoice. To cap this all off, we also complete a one-year check-in with The Steward’s Promise.

Common questions Tucson homeowners ask before remodeling.
-
It depends on the scope: layout changes, cabinetry level, countertops, and how far plumbing/electrical moves. We price with a line-item scope so you can see where the money goes and choose options that fit your budget.
Generally speaking, kitchen remodels average between $30K-$150K+, depending on scope, size, and finishes. -
Timeline depends on complexity (simple refresh vs. moving plumbing, custom tile, or layout changes). We build a schedule during planning and keep you updated weekly so you always know what’s next.
Generally speaking, for a small bathroom like a powder bath, it can take two (2) weeks up to three (3) months for very complex primary bath renovations.
-
It is completely dependent on the scope, but permitting is necessary when you do things like move plumbing, electrical, walls, windows/doors, convert non-livable to livable, or change structural elements. We’ll tell you clearly what’s required and handle the permit path when needed.
-
Often yes, depending on the rooms affected. We plan phases and use dust control and site protection to reduce disruption, then we’ll be honest about what’s realistic for your project.
-
The biggest cause is unclear scope. The second is changes made midstream without clear pricing. We prevent both with a detailed scope, options when needed, and written change orders only.
-
No problem, changes happen. If it’s outside the agreed scope, we price it clearly, put it in writing, and get approval before moving forward.
